Terroir & Origin
En Luraule is a Village-level vineyard site in Meursault, renowned for its stony soils. These impart the wine’s characteristic minerality and tension – less opulent than the Premier Crus, but more linear and precise.
Grape Variety & Vinification
100% Chardonnay, consistently aged in oak barrels, with only one fifth in new barrels. Jobard increasingly favours larger 600-litre Stockinger barrels, which keep the wine slender and mineral-driven. Two winters‘ maturation in barrel, no filtration – the result is a wine of natural stability and impressive complexity.

Special Features
The magnum format guarantees slower, more harmonious development. The Jobard family has been cultivating vineyards in Meursault since the 16th century – tradition and modernity united in a single bottle.
